Two DARTMOUTH MEN stepped up to top positions among American flyers in Europe when Col. David C. Schilling '39 and Lt. Col. John C. Meyer '41 early in January ran their grand totals of German planes shot down up to and 37, respectively.

Both men have been in the Army Air Forces since 1939- Colonel Schilling holds the Distinguished Flying Cross, the Silver Star, and the Air Medal with clusters. Colonel Meyer has been awarded the Distinguished Flying Cross with three clusters, the Air Medal with three clusters and the Silver Star.

At Dartmouth Schilling, who graduated, majored in geology and Meyer was studying medicine at the time he left to enlist.
